The Spotlight on Madison LES Hotel

Stylish Lower East Side Stay with Skyline Views

Modern and sleek, Madison LES Hotel offers a comfortable, contemporary base in the heart of Manhattan’s Lower East Side. Just a short walk or subway ride from NYC’s biggest concert venues, this hotel blends convenience with city charm. Guests love the rooftop terrace for unwinding after a show, and the free WiFi makes it easy to keep the night alive online.

With iconic neighborhoods like SoHo, the Financial District, and the Brooklyn Bridge all within 1.2 miles, you’re perfectly placed to explore the city before or after your gig.

Why Concert-goers love it

Location is key—and Madison LES delivers. You're within easy reach of major venues in both Manhattan and Brooklyn, and the nearby subway lines make late-night returns a breeze. While it's in a lively area, the hotel itself is tucked on a relatively quiet street, offering a peaceful retreat after a high-energy night out. The 3pm check-in and 11am check-out give you enough time to rest and recover.

What People Say

Guests love the friendly staff, the clean and modern rooms, and the unbeatable location for both sightseeing and nightlife. Reviewers also mention the rooftop as a hidden gem with views of the skyline. The hotel gets nods for being affordable by NYC standards, especially considering its location.

Areas for Improvement

Rooms can be on the smaller side—typical for NYC—but they’re functional and well-kept. Breakfast isn’t included, and some guests noted that the elevators can be slow during peak times. Still, most agree it’s a fair trade for the price and location.

The Bottom Line

Madison LES Hotel is a clean, stylish, and budget-friendly base for concert-goers who want to stay close to the action but sleep in peace.
